The Cabrinha Ace Hybrid 03 board represents the culmination of three years of meticulous design work by the Cab Design Works team. This board has undergone a complete transformation with a fresh outline and redesigned bottom contour.
Describing the Cabrinha Ace Hybrid as lively is an understatement. Its ‘hybrid’ composition, featuring dual Carbon stringers, honeycomb foam, and a paulownia mix core, strikes the perfect balance between strength and weight. This innovative board design offers exceptional versatility and effortlessly excels across various riding styles.
In today’s kiteboarding world, versatility is key, whether you’re into huge airs, wave slashing, powered tricks, or freeriding. The Cabrinha Ace Hybrid seamlessly bridges the freeride spectrum, making it the highest-performing ‘Do it all’ board in our range.
Cabrinha Ace Hybrid Design Profile:
- High-performance board with structural carbon and lightweight composite core, enhancing flex pattern for heightened response and explosive pop.
Features:
- NEW: Double center concave
- NEW: 4-degree angled fins for enhanced grip
- NEW: Refined volume flow for improved dynamics
- NEW: Centered deck grab rails for progressive board-off maneuvers
- Quad channels in the tips for grip when loading off the back foot
- Medium rocker line for early planing lift and reliable edge hold
- Moderate/low flex pattern for rapid response and intuitive pop
- High-end hybrid core construction for lively performance in all conditions
- Exclusive and strategic use of Japanese Toray UD carbon for precision feedback
- Included with the board: 4x 40mm fins, 4x washers, 10x m6x16mm screws, grab handle.
